NALBARI WEST
Assembly seat no. 62 in Assam · Vidhan Sabha seat contested 3 times since 1962.
Every election in this seat
| Year | Winner | Runner-up | Margin | Margin % | Candidates | Turnout |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1972 | INCBHUMIDHAR BARMAN | CPITARUNSEN DEKA | 8,505 | 22.61% | 3 | 60.5% |
| 1967 | INCB. BARMAN | CPIT.S. DEKA | 1,028 | 3.55% | 6 | 55.8% |
| 19621961 boundaries | INCSRIMAN PRAFULLA GOSWAMI | CPITARUN SEN DEKA | 5,666 | 19.31% | 4 | 54.5% |
